Output 66df6c3e3c7c0990534cf5e91868c38d18c0d0b1314de882751694ef48252ef7:1

value
320239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8913bf3b093d69264228ff8b1cd4ee990c437e8d OP_EQUAL
address
3EBp9sQ7nrAb2tjVRxjL71BF26RXCRZHsL
transaction
66df6c3e3c7c0990534cf5e91868c38d18c0d0b1314de882751694ef48252ef7
spent
true